The Yellow Canary (also known as Evil Come, Evil Go, Easy Come, Easy Go and Crime Against the King ) is a 1963 American thriller film directed by Buzz Kulik and starring Pat Boone and Barbara Eden. It was adapted by Rod Serling from a novel by Whit Masterson.The film was photographed by veteran Floyd Crosby and scored by jazz composer Kenyon Hopkins.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
